编程什么时候会变成课程

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程变成课程的时间点通常取决于以下几个因素:

    1. 教育需求:当社会对于编程技能的需求增加时,编程往往会成为课程。随着科技的不断发展,编程已经成为了许多行业的基本技能需求,包括软件开发、数据分析、人工智能等。因此,学校和教育机构开始将编程纳入课程中,以满足人才市场的需求。

    2. 教育政策:政府的教育政策也是决定编程是否成为课程的重要因素。一些国家或地区已经将编程纳入了教育体系中,将其视为基本的科学技术素养之一。政府的支持和推动能够帮助编程更早地成为课程。

    3. 教育资源:编程课程的推广还需要有相应的教育资源支持,包括教材、教师培训、实验室设备等。只有具备这些资源,学校和教育机构才能够有效地开设编程课程,让学生接触和学习编程知识。

    4. 学生兴趣:学生对于编程的兴趣也是编程课程能否成立的重要因素。如果学生对编程感兴趣,积极参与学习,那么学校和教育机构就有动力开设编程课程。因此,教育机构应该积极引导学生对编程感兴趣,提供相关的学习机会和活动。

    综上所述,编程成为课程的时间取决于教育需求、教育政策、教育资源和学生兴趣等因素的综合影响。随着社会对编程技能的重视程度不断提高,编程课程的开设将会越来越普遍。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程成为课程的时间可以追溯到计算机的发展初期。随着计算机科学的快速发展和普及,编程已经成为了一门重要的学科,被广泛地纳入到学校的教育体系中。以下是编程成为课程的几个关键时刻:

    1. 1960年代:基础编程语言的出现
      在1960年代,出现了一些重要的编程语言,如FORTRAN和COBOL。这些语言为计算机编程提供了更高级的抽象,使得编程更加容易上手和理解。这些编程语言的出现促使学校开始教授编程课程,培养学生的计算机编程技能。

    2. 1980年代:个人电脑的普及
      个人电脑的普及使得编程变得更加普遍和易于学习。在这个时期,学校开始将编程作为一门独立的课程引入到计算机科学教育中。学生可以通过编写简单的程序来学习计算机的基本原理和逻辑思维。

    3. 1990年代:互联网的兴起
      互联网的兴起使得编程变得更加重要和普遍。学校开始将编程课程与互联网相关的内容结合起来,教授学生如何构建网站和开发网络应用程序。这个时期也是网页编程语言如HTML和JavaScript的兴起时期,这些语言成为了学生学习编程的重要工具。

    4. 2000年代:移动应用的崛起
      随着智能手机和移动应用的兴起,学校开始将移动应用开发作为编程课程的一部分。学生可以学习如何开发iOS和Android应用程序,培养创新和解决问题的能力。移动应用开发成为了吸引学生学习编程的重要因素之一。

    5. 21世纪:编程教育的普及
      随着信息技术的快速发展,编程教育在全球范围内得到了广泛的普及。越来越多的学校将编程纳入到课程中,甚至在小学阶段就开始教授基础的编程知识。编程教育的目标不仅仅是培养学生的计算机编程技能,更重要的是培养学生的创新、解决问题和团队合作的能力。

    总的来说,编程成为课程的时间可以追溯到计算机的发展初期,随着计算机科学的快速发展和普及,编程已经成为了一门重要的学科,并被广泛地纳入到学校的教育体系中。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程作为一门学科,通常会在中小学的计算机课程中进行教授。此外,许多大学也设有相关的计算机科学专业,其中包括编程课程。此外,还有许多在线学习平台和编程学院提供编程课程,供任何人学习和提高编程技能。

    下面将从不同的角度讲解编程课程的内容、方法和操作流程。

    一、课程内容:

    1.基础概念:编程课程通常会介绍编程的基本概念,如变量、数据类型、运算符、控制流程等。学生将学习如何使用这些概念来解决问题和实现算法。

    2.编程语言:编程课程通常会教授一种或多种编程语言,如Python、Java、C++等。学生将学习这些语言的语法和语义,并通过编写代码来实践所学知识。

    3.数据结构和算法:编程课程还会介绍常用的数据结构和算法,如数组、链表、栈、队列、排序算法、查找算法等。学生将学习如何选择和实现合适的数据结构和算法来解决问题。

    4.软件开发:在编程课程中,学生将学习软件开发的基本流程,包括需求分析、设计、编码、测试和维护。他们还将学习如何使用版本控制工具、调试工具和集成开发环境等。

    二、教学方法:

    1.理论讲解:编程课程通常会通过课堂讲解的方式向学生传授编程知识。教师将解释编程概念和原理,并提供示例代码来帮助学生理解。

    2.实践演练:编程课程强调实践,学生将通过编写代码来巩固所学知识。教师会提供编程练习和项目任务,学生需要独立完成并提交代码。

    3.小组合作:编程课程通常会鼓励学生进行小组合作,通过共同解决问题和交流经验来提高编程技能。学生可以一起编写代码、讨论算法等。

    4.实例分析:编程课程还会通过实例分析来展示编程技术的应用。教师会选择一些实际问题,并演示如何使用编程解决这些问题。

    三、操作流程:

    1.培养兴趣:编程课程通常会从培养学生对编程的兴趣开始。教师会介绍编程的应用领域和发展前景,激发学生学习的动力。

    2.基础知识学习:编程课程会从基础知识学习开始。学生将学习编程语言的基本语法和常用概念,如变量、运算符等。

    3.实践练习:在学习基础知识后,学生将进行实践练习。他们将通过编写简单的程序来巩固所学知识,并逐渐提高编程能力。

    4.进阶学习:在掌握基础知识后,学生将进一步学习高级编程概念和技术。他们将学习数据结构、算法、面向对象编程等内容。

    5.项目实践:编程课程通常会有项目实践环节。学生将根据教师的要求,独立或小组完成一个具体的项目,如开发一个简单的应用程序或网站。

    6.综合评估:编程课程通常会有综合评估环节,包括考试、作业和项目评分等。这些评估将检验学生对编程知识的掌握程度和实际应用能力。

    总之,编程课程通过教授基础概念、编程语言、数据结构和算法等内容,采用理论讲解、实践演练、小组合作和实例分析等教学方法,培养学生的编程兴趣和技能。学生将按照一定的操作流程进行学习,逐步提高编程能力,并通过综合评估检验学习成果。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部